Re-polling ordered in one booth in Uttarakhand
The Election Commission of India has ordered for re-polling in one polling booth of Lohaghat constituency in Uttarakhand. The re-polling was ordered after an electronic voting machine did not display data due to technical glitches. One EVM in booth number 128 in Government inter college at Karankarayat stopped displaying results while counting was underway on Saturday.

Fresh polling will be held on March 15. Election commission officials said that counting of votes will be conducted the same day and results will be announced in the evening. The results from all other booths in the constituency will be preserved till re-polling on March 15.
BJP candidate Puran singh Fartyal was leading by 450 votes when the EVM stopped displaying results.
